An unsuspecting 'geek', Paul (Iain De Caestecker) is able to see the spirits of the dead. Things take a turn for the worst when a vengeful spirit, or Fade, breaks through to our world and Paul's friends and family are in the firing line. This release includes the entire first series of BBC3's eerie supernatural drama.
